Attar park & ‘scent of politics’ — why SP-era plan to boost UP’s Kannauj perfumers has gone stale

International Perfume Museum and Park (now called Attar Park) was conceived of as an exchange of technical expertise between Kannauj and the French perfume capital, Grasse.

Fragrant but expensive, sandalwood is giving Kannauj’s perfume industry a headache

Kannauj makes raw materials for the fragrance and flavour industry. But the Rs 3,000-crore cottage industry is struggling.

Where even drains smell of roses — inside India’s perfumery Kannauj on World Fragrance Day

Ancient city of Kannauj traces its perfume-making history to Mughal empress Nur Jahan. It continues the legacy of making ‘attar’ through hydro-distillation technique.
